afaik, ff does not allow for wider dof, and i don't recall seeing anyone on this forum seriously make that claim.

QuoteOriginally posted by Na Horuk Quote
FF has much higher diffraction limit.
i used to think that, in a fuzzy sort of way, but in reality, when the dof is equal, so is the diffraction... no advantage either way.

what ff does do is move the threshold for diffraction further up the aperture scale, so if the lens doesn't clean up on the sides until f/11, you are better off with ff.

but a well-designed aps-c lens, that's fully cleaned up on the sides, as good as it's going to get, by f/8, is right where you want it.

I don't know. I look at a lot of full frame images and wonder why folks would need an ILC at all to take the images. Folks on the full frame image thread here on the forum like Mark Lj and V5 were taking awesome photos with their K5s before they "moved up." I can't honestly look at Mark's photos and tell which were taken with which format at web sizes, although I'm sure printed large enough you can see a difference. But I really think the differences are overblown. Poor photographers continue to be poor photographers, even when they have more "headroom" and great photographers are great whatever format they are using.

I do find it interesting that all of these discussions come back to depth of field. It seems as though folks who are big proponents of full frame really feel strongly that shallow depth of field is the be-all-end-all of photography. I suppose that is because this is the biggest area where it is easy to tell the difference between full frame shots and smaller format shots. But it feels like that is actually a fairly small segment of photography and not terribly important in many settings as a reason to buy a camera. Since the dynamic range and high iso capability are intimately connected with shallow depth of field (the only way to get better dynamic range on a full frame camera is to shoot with shallower depth of field), it follows that the places where you actually see benefit tend to be in things like portraiture. Landscapes may have some improvement, but when you realize that a camera like the K5 has 14.1 stops of dynamic range, while the D800 has 14.5 at base iso, it doesn't follow that you are going to see huge benefits as long as you are using good technique, are stabilized, and shooting at base iso, except with an increase in printing size.

I guess I have been rambling here. I plan to buy a full frame camera. I'm saving for it now. I will just say that I am bothered (a) by full frame advocates who believe that it is better than all other formats, usually because of some weird use of " equivalence theory and (b) by people who can't understand photography that involves stopping down a lens.
